Built in the 15th century by Francesco Sforza, Duke of Milan, on the remains of a 14th-century fortification. It was one of the largest citadels in Europe. Largely remade by Luca Beltrami in 1891–1905

The Gothic cathedral took nearly six centuries to complete. It is the fifth largest cathedral in the world and the largest in the Italian state territory.

This world-renowned opera house was built in 1778, where many composers wrote and conducted works including such greats as Rossini, Puccini, Verdi and Toscanini.
